Residents posed to danger

Resident writes letter to the editor on a hole left behind by the City of Ekurhuleni.

EDITOR – On 17 Bradford Road in Bedfordview there is a hole that is posing a danger to the pedestrians and vehicles that are moving in and out of the premises.

The matter was reported three months ago to the municipality.

The water and sanitation department dug up the road to fix a leak, but have left a hole open after fixing the leak.

Some of the staff members working shifts at 17 Bradford walking to the taxi rank during the evening have been injured.

I have called the call centre and they just sent me from pillar to post.

Lesego Motsamai.

EDITOR’S COMMENT – City of Ekurhuleni spokesperson Themba Gadebe commented as follows:

We have investigated this matter and found that the site was not restored.

The city has made arrangement for the site to be back-filled and the paving repaired.

There is no record of a call logged for the said address in the past six months on the logging system, e-MIS.

The city always takes reasonable steps to avoid hazardous situations and attend to them whenever they are reported.
